HTML5平台上的铅笔画渲染技术研究
需积分: 8 100 浏览量
更新于2024-09-05
收藏 590KB PDF 举报
"这篇论文探讨了基于HTML5平台的铅笔画风格渲染技术,通过改进运动模糊滤镜的铅笔纹理仿真算法,提出了一种新型的非真实感渲染方法。该方法首先使用高斯模糊的Unsharp Mask (USM) 锐化技术处理输入图像以创建铅笔画基础图,然后利用自定义的运动模糊算法生成铅笔纹理,并对结果进行锐化滤波。之后,将处理后的图像与边缘提取图像融合,最终形成具有逼真和层次感的铅笔画效果。此方法已被实现在HTML5平台上,适用于Web应用领域,且实验表明其生成速度快、渲染质量高。"
论文深入研究了非真实感渲染(Non-Photorealistic Rendering, NPR)技术,特别是针对铅笔画风格的模拟。传统的铅笔画风格转换通常依赖于复杂的图像处理技术,而该论文提出的新方法通过优化运动模糊滤镜的铅笔纹理模拟,提高了效率和效果。Unsharp Mask技术是一种常见的图像增强技术,它通过对比度增强来使图像细节更加清晰。在此基础上,结合高斯模糊,可以更精确地模拟铅笔画的质感。
运动模糊算法是另一个关键点,它能捕捉到物体运动的连续性,从而在铅笔画中模拟出动态的效果。论文中自主实现的运动模糊算法为生成铅笔纹理提供了创新手段,使得生成的铅笔画风格更加接近手绘。
锐化滤波和边缘提取是图像处理中用于突出图像轮廓和细节的常用步骤。在铅笔画风格渲染中,这些步骤有助于强化线条,使其更符合铅笔画的特征。通过将这两者与运动模糊图像融合,能够创造出既具有动态感又不失细节的铅笔画效果。
最后,将这种方法应用于HTML5平台,意味着用户可以在Web浏览器上实时体验这种铅笔画风格的渲染,无需安装额外的软件或插件。这大大拓宽了铅笔画风格渲染的应用范围,包括在线艺术创作工具、网页设计、互动媒体等。
该论文的贡献在于提供了一种高效、逼真的铅笔画风格渲染方法,通过HTML5平台的实现,使得该技术在Web环境中更具实用性和普适性,对于计算机图形学、Web开发以及数字艺术等领域具有重要的理论和实践价值。
2019-09-11 上传
2019-11-07 上传
2019-09-12 上传
2021-09-25 上传
2019-09-20 上传
2021-09-12 上传
2021-09-25 上传
2021-04-08 上传
weixin_38744207
- 粉丝: 344
- 资源: 2万+
最新资源
- Android圆角进度条控件的设计与应用
- mui框架实现带侧边栏的响应式布局
- Android仿知乎横线直线进度条实现教程
- SSM选课系统实现:Spring+SpringMVC+MyBatis源码剖析
- 使用JavaScript开发的流星待办事项应用
- Google Code Jam 2015竞赛回顾与Java编程实践
- Angular 2与NW.js集成:通过Webpack和Gulp构建环境详解
- OneDayTripPlanner:数字化城市旅游活动规划助手
- TinySTM 轻量级原子操作库的详细介绍与安装指南
- 模拟PHP序列化:JavaScript实现序列化与反序列化技术
- ***进销存系统全面功能介绍与开发指南
- 掌握Clojure命名空间的正确重新加载技巧
- 免费获取VMD模态分解Matlab源代码与案例数据
- BuglyEasyToUnity最新更新优化:简化Unity开发者接入流程
- Android学生俱乐部项目任务2解析与实践
- 掌握Elixir语言构建高效分布式网络爬虫